mirror of
https://git.freebsd.org/ports.git
synced 2025-07-18 17:59:20 -04:00
Modify BSDPAN to make INSTALLSITEMAN1DIR and INSTALLSITEMAN3DIR be equal
to INSTALLMAN1DIR and INSTALLMAN3DIR, respectively, if there are no corresponding variables in Config.pm, which is unfortunately the case for perl 5.8.0. This fixes manpage installation path for p5 ports built with perl5.8.0 as /usr/bin/perl.
This commit is contained in:
parent
986bb52ae4
commit
7f388ae919
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/head/; revision=63390
10 changed files with 20 additions and 10 deletions
|
@ -7,6 +7,7 @@
|
||||||
|
|
||||||
PORTNAME= perl
|
PORTNAME= perl
|
||||||
PORTVERSION= ${PERL_VER}
|
PORTVERSION= ${PERL_VER}
|
||||||
|
PORTREVISION= 1
|
||||||
CATEGORIES= lang devel perl5
|
CATEGORIES= lang devel perl5
|
||||||
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
${MASTER_SITE_LOCAL:S/$/:local/} \
|
${MASTER_SITE_LOCAL:S/$/:local/} \
|
||||||
|
@ -14,7 +15,7 @@ M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
MASTER_SITE_SUBDIR= ../../src \
|
MASTER_SITE_SUBDIR= ../../src \
|
||||||
tobez/:local ./:local
|
tobez/:local ./:local
|
||||||
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
||||||
BSDPAN-${PORTVERSION}${EXTRACT_SUFX}:local
|
BSDPAN-${PORTVERSION}_${BSDPAN_REVISION}${EXTRACT_SUFX}:local
|
||||||
|
|
||||||
MAINTAINER= tobez@FreeBSD.org
|
MAINTAINER= tobez@FreeBSD.org
|
||||||
|
|
||||||
|
@ -163,6 +164,7 @@ BSDPAN_DEST= ${PREFIX}/lib/perl5/${PERL_VER}/BSDPAN
|
||||||
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
||||||
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
||||||
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
||||||
|
BSDPAN_REVISION=1
|
||||||
|
|
||||||
post-patch:
|
post-patch:
|
||||||
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
||||||
|
|
|
@ -1,2 +1,2 @@
|
||||||
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
||||||
MD5 (BSDPAN-5.8.0.tar.gz) = 4b20e5c8feb22c861084659b4209c842
|
MD5 (BSDPAN-5.8.0_1.tar.gz) = af9f075e073b14714cfeb8a7582013e7
|
||||||
|
|
|
@ -7,6 +7,7 @@
|
||||||
|
|
||||||
PORTNAME= perl
|
PORTNAME= perl
|
||||||
PORTVERSION= ${PERL_VER}
|
PORTVERSION= ${PERL_VER}
|
||||||
|
PORTREVISION= 1
|
||||||
CATEGORIES= lang devel perl5
|
CATEGORIES= lang devel perl5
|
||||||
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
${MASTER_SITE_LOCAL:S/$/:local/} \
|
${MASTER_SITE_LOCAL:S/$/:local/} \
|
||||||
|
@ -14,7 +15,7 @@ M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
MASTER_SITE_SUBDIR= ../../src \
|
MASTER_SITE_SUBDIR= ../../src \
|
||||||
tobez/:local ./:local
|
tobez/:local ./:local
|
||||||
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
||||||
BSDPAN-${PORTVERSION}${EXTRACT_SUFX}:local
|
BSDPAN-${PORTVERSION}_${BSDPAN_REVISION}${EXTRACT_SUFX}:local
|
||||||
|
|
||||||
MAINTAINER= tobez@FreeBSD.org
|
MAINTAINER= tobez@FreeBSD.org
|
||||||
|
|
||||||
|
@ -163,6 +164,7 @@ BSDPAN_DEST= ${PREFIX}/lib/perl5/${PERL_VER}/BSDPAN
|
||||||
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
||||||
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
||||||
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
||||||
|
BSDPAN_REVISION=1
|
||||||
|
|
||||||
post-patch:
|
post-patch:
|
||||||
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
||||||
|
|
|
@ -1,2 +1,2 @@
|
||||||
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
||||||
MD5 (BSDPAN-5.8.0.tar.gz) = 4b20e5c8feb22c861084659b4209c842
|
MD5 (BSDPAN-5.8.0_1.tar.gz) = af9f075e073b14714cfeb8a7582013e7
|
||||||
|
|
|
@ -7,6 +7,7 @@
|
||||||
|
|
||||||
PORTNAME= perl
|
PORTNAME= perl
|
||||||
PORTVERSION= ${PERL_VER}
|
PORTVERSION= ${PERL_VER}
|
||||||
|
PORTREVISION= 1
|
||||||
CATEGORIES= lang devel perl5
|
CATEGORIES= lang devel perl5
|
||||||
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
${MASTER_SITE_LOCAL:S/$/:local/} \
|
${MASTER_SITE_LOCAL:S/$/:local/} \
|
||||||
|
@ -14,7 +15,7 @@ M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
MASTER_SITE_SUBDIR= ../../src \
|
MASTER_SITE_SUBDIR= ../../src \
|
||||||
tobez/:local ./:local
|
tobez/:local ./:local
|
||||||
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
||||||
BSDPAN-${PORTVERSION}${EXTRACT_SUFX}:local
|
BSDPAN-${PORTVERSION}_${BSDPAN_REVISION}${EXTRACT_SUFX}:local
|
||||||
|
|
||||||
MAINTAINER= tobez@FreeBSD.org
|
MAINTAINER= tobez@FreeBSD.org
|
||||||
|
|
||||||
|
@ -163,6 +164,7 @@ BSDPAN_DEST= ${PREFIX}/lib/perl5/${PERL_VER}/BSDPAN
|
||||||
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
||||||
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
||||||
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
||||||
|
BSDPAN_REVISION=1
|
||||||
|
|
||||||
post-patch:
|
post-patch:
|
||||||
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
||||||
|
|
|
@ -1,2 +1,2 @@
|
||||||
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
||||||
MD5 (BSDPAN-5.8.0.tar.gz) = 4b20e5c8feb22c861084659b4209c842
|
MD5 (BSDPAN-5.8.0_1.tar.gz) = af9f075e073b14714cfeb8a7582013e7
|
||||||
|
|
|
@ -7,6 +7,7 @@
|
||||||
|
|
||||||
PORTNAME= perl
|
PORTNAME= perl
|
||||||
PORTVERSION= ${PERL_VER}
|
PORTVERSION= ${PERL_VER}
|
||||||
|
PORTREVISION= 1
|
||||||
CATEGORIES= lang devel perl5
|
CATEGORIES= lang devel perl5
|
||||||
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
${MASTER_SITE_LOCAL:S/$/:local/} \
|
${MASTER_SITE_LOCAL:S/$/:local/} \
|
||||||
|
@ -14,7 +15,7 @@ M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
MASTER_SITE_SUBDIR= ../../src \
|
MASTER_SITE_SUBDIR= ../../src \
|
||||||
tobez/:local ./:local
|
tobez/:local ./:local
|
||||||
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
||||||
BSDPAN-${PORTVERSION}${EXTRACT_SUFX}:local
|
BSDPAN-${PORTVERSION}_${BSDPAN_REVISION}${EXTRACT_SUFX}:local
|
||||||
|
|
||||||
MAINTAINER= tobez@FreeBSD.org
|
MAINTAINER= tobez@FreeBSD.org
|
||||||
|
|
||||||
|
@ -163,6 +164,7 @@ BSDPAN_DEST= ${PREFIX}/lib/perl5/${PERL_VER}/BSDPAN
|
||||||
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
||||||
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
||||||
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
||||||
|
BSDPAN_REVISION=1
|
||||||
|
|
||||||
post-patch:
|
post-patch:
|
||||||
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
||||||
|
|
|
@ -1,2 +1,2 @@
|
||||||
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
||||||
MD5 (BSDPAN-5.8.0.tar.gz) = 4b20e5c8feb22c861084659b4209c842
|
MD5 (BSDPAN-5.8.0_1.tar.gz) = af9f075e073b14714cfeb8a7582013e7
|
||||||
|
|
|
@ -7,6 +7,7 @@
|
||||||
|
|
||||||
PORTNAME= perl
|
PORTNAME= perl
|
||||||
PORTVERSION= ${PERL_VER}
|
PORTVERSION= ${PERL_VER}
|
||||||
|
PORTREVISION= 1
|
||||||
CATEGORIES= lang devel perl5
|
CATEGORIES= lang devel perl5
|
||||||
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
${MASTER_SITE_LOCAL:S/$/:local/} \
|
${MASTER_SITE_LOCAL:S/$/:local/} \
|
||||||
|
@ -14,7 +15,7 @@ MASTER_SITES= ${MASTER_SITE_PERL_CPAN} \
|
||||||
MASTER_SITE_SUBDIR= ../../src \
|
MASTER_SITE_SUBDIR= ../../src \
|
||||||
tobez/:local ./:local
|
tobez/:local ./:local
|
||||||
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
DISTFILES= ${DISTNAME}${EXTRACT_SUFX} \
|
||||||
BSDPAN-${PORTVERSION}${EXTRACT_SUFX}:local
|
BSDPAN-${PORTVERSION}_${BSDPAN_REVISION}${EXTRACT_SUFX}:local
|
||||||
|
|
||||||
MAINTAINER= tobez@FreeBSD.org
|
MAINTAINER= tobez@FreeBSD.org
|
||||||
|
|
||||||
|
@ -163,6 +164,7 @@ BSDPAN_DEST= ${PREFIX}/lib/perl5/${PERL_VER}/BSDPAN
|
||||||
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
BSDPAN_FILES= BSDPAN.pm BSDPAN/Override.pm Config.pm \
|
||||||
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
ExtUtils/MM_Unix.pm ExtUtils/Packlist.pm
|
||||||
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
BSDPAN_WRKSRC= ${WRKDIR}/BSDPAN-${PORTVERSION}
|
||||||
|
BSDPAN_REVISION=1
|
||||||
|
|
||||||
post-patch:
|
post-patch:
|
||||||
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
${SED} -e 's|%%PREFIX%%|${PREFIX}|g;' \
|
||||||
|
|
|
@ -1,2 +1,2 @@
|
||||||
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
MD5 (perl-5.8.0.tar.gz) = d9bdb180620306023fd35901a2878b62
|
||||||
MD5 (BSDPAN-5.8.0.tar.gz) = 4b20e5c8feb22c861084659b4209c842
|
MD5 (BSDPAN-5.8.0_1.tar.gz) = af9f075e073b14714cfeb8a7582013e7
|
||||||
|
|
Loading…
Add table
Reference in a new issue